The Importance Of Conveyor Belt Drive Rollers In Industrial Operations
conveyor belt drive rollers are an essential component of any industrial conveyor system. They play a crucial role in ensuring the smooth and efficient movement of materials in a production facility. These rollers are responsible for driving the conveyor belt and moving products from one point to another. One of the primary functions of conveyor belt drive rollers is to provide power to the conveyor belt, enabling it to transport goods along the production line. The drive rollers are typically powered by an electric motor, which drives the rotation of the rollers and moves the belt. This continuous movement is essential for the timely and efficient transfer of materials within a facility. Without properly functioning drive rollers, the entire conveyor system would come to a standstill, causing delays in production and disrupting workflow.
In addition to providing power to the conveyor belt, drive rollers also help to maintain tension in the belt. Proper tension is crucial for ensuring that the belt does not slip or become misaligned during operation. Drive rollers are designed to apply the necessary force to keep the belt in place and prevent any unwanted movement. This helps to maintain the stability of the conveyor system and ensures that materials are moved smoothly from one end to the other.
There are several different types of conveyor belt drive rollers available, each with its own set of benefits and applications. One common type is the flat belt drive roller, which features a smooth surface that provides excellent traction and stability for the conveyor belt. These rollers are ideal for transporting lightweight or fragile materials, as they minimize the risk of slippage and damage to the products being transported.
Another popular type of drive roller is the crowned drive roller, which has a slightly curved surface that helps to center the belt and prevent tracking issues. This type of roller is often used in applications where the conveyor belt needs to navigate curves or bends in the production line. The crowned surface of the roller ensures that the belt stays on track and maintains proper alignment throughout its journey.
Chain drive rollers are another common type of conveyor belt drive roller, which are specifically designed for heavy-duty applications. These rollers feature sprockets that engage with a chain, providing extra power and torque to move large, heavy loads along the conveyor system. Chain drive rollers are typically used in industries such as mining, automotive manufacturing, and logistics, where conveyor systems need to transport heavy materials over long distances.
Regardless of the type of conveyor belt drive roller used, regular maintenance and inspection are essential to ensure optimal performance and longevity. Over time, drive rollers can become worn or damaged due to the constant friction and stress of moving materials. It is important to check for signs of wear, such as cracks, dents, or warping, and replace any damaged rollers promptly to prevent disruptions in production.
